The Rise of a Western County on a Trillion-Cubic-Meter Gas Field

Deep News14:32

The construction site at the Gaoshi 001-X67 well in Yunfeng Township, Anyue County, Ziyang City, is a hive of activity. On June 3rd, a 13-inch casing pipe was slowly lowered into a 7,000-meter-deep formation, marking the completion of intermediate casing and the first cementing operation. Just a month prior, the Gaoshi 018-H8 well in the same block delivered excellent news: a test production rate exceeding 800,000 cubic meters per day, with an absolute open flow potential surpassing one million cubic meters.

Anyue Gas Field boasts proven reserves of 1.45 trillion cubic meters, accounting for 7.6% of the national total and 33.3% of the provincial total. From January to May this year, the county produced a cumulative 3.8 billion cubic meters of natural gas, a 35% year-on-year increase. It also processed 3.8 billion cubic meters of raw gas (up 90%), generated 1.3 billion kilowatt-hours of electricity (up 42%), and contributed 500 million yuan in tax revenue from the entire industrial chain. These figures mark a strong start to the 15th Five-Year Plan period.

Technological Breakthroughs: Achieving Self-Reliance in Drilling

"We used to rely on foreign companies for rotary steerable systems, which were expensive both in terms of equipment and service costs. Now, using domestic equipment and technology, we can complete a well over 6,000 meters deep in just six months," explained the head of the Chuanqing Drilling 70289 team, standing by the rig. Today, domestically produced downhole tools transmit real-time data on temperature, direction, and inclination, keeping the drill bit's trajectory deviation within two to three degrees.

Drilling fluid, often called the "blood" of drilling, presents a significant challenge in density control. "If the density is too high, it can fracture the formation; if it's too low, it can't contain the gas. The slightest mistake could lead to an incident," the team's drilling technical supervisor noted. Different formations have varying pressures, necessitating pre-optimized plans and precise operations. Simultaneously, solid control equipment continuously purifies the circulating mud, removing impurities like rock cuttings to enhance safety and efficiency.

During the 14th Five-Year Plan period, Anyue's annual natural gas production surged from 3.8 billion cubic meters in 2021 to 7.5 billion cubic meters in 2025, a jump of over 96%. This growth is underpinned by the continuous efforts from 342 exploration and development wells and the repeated success of proprietary technology in conquering complex geological conditions. For the 15th Five-Year Plan period, Anyue plans to drill 75 new wells in key blocks like Gaoshiti and actively initiate shale gas development, aiming for an annual production target of 10 billion cubic meters.

Hub Enhancement: Intelligent Purification for Secure Supply

Efficient purification and safe transportation are critical links connecting upstream extraction with downstream markets. The Ziyang Branch of the Southwest Oil & Gas Field Natural Gas Purification Plant, which commenced operations in September 2025, serves as a vital node in upgrading Anyue's oil and gas industrial chain. From January to May, the plant processed over 3 billion cubic meters of natural gas, completing 67% of its annual target while maintaining a product qualification rate of 100%.

"Raw sour gas from upstream undergoes processes like desulfurization, dehydration, and sulfur recovery, reducing hydrogen sulfide content to below 6 milligrams per cubic meter, fully meeting national Class I gas standards," said Zhao Shumei, deputy director of the Ziyang branch. The plant employs intelligent technologies like advanced process control and real-time optimization, cutting adjustment time during gas quality fluctuations from 30 minutes down to 5-10 minutes, enabling faster and more precise equipment response.

This flexibility is also evident in regional supply coordination. Leveraging the Southwest Oil & Gas Field's pipeline network layout, the Ziyang branch achieves interconnectivity, gas volume exchange, and load balancing with other purification plants in the region. Similar to a highway network, if maintenance is required or an incident occurs at one point, production loads can be quickly shifted elsewhere to ensure a stable and secure gas supply.

While ensuring stable production and supply, meticulous management remains a priority. To address issues like scaling and reduced throughput in high-salinity wastewater evaporation crystallization units, technical teams optimized chemical dosing and cleaned core heat exchange equipment, restoring full-load operation within 24 hours and overcoming production bottlenecks through refined management. Currently, Anyue has two operational natural gas purification plants. Purified gas is partly transported via major energy arteries like the West-East Gas Pipeline to central and eastern China, while another portion is retained locally in Anyue for more value-added "secondary entrepreneurship."

Industrial Deepening: Adding Value Before the Gas Leaves Home

Abundant gas resources and a robust purification, storage, and transportation system mean Anyue is no longer content with merely selling raw materials. Not every cubic meter of natural gas needs to travel far; increasingly, "Anyue gas" is being converted and its value enhanced right at its source, transforming a "gas resource base" into an "industrial hub."

In Yongshun Town, Anyue County, Sichuan Investment (Ziyang) Gas Power Generation Co., Ltd. has delivered impressive results: generating over 4 billion kilowatt-hours of electricity and consuming 760 million cubic meters of natural gas, laying a solid foundation for industrial upgrading. Inside the company's smart control center, a large screen displays real-time operational parameters of the generating units. Lead operator Li Tao and his colleagues work in 24-hour shifts. "Our task is to execute dispatch instructions accurately, ensuring the safe and efficient operation of the units. Any change in dispatch instructions requires precise operation to maximize the conversion of every cubic meter of natural gas into electricity," Li Tao stated.

Qu Ming, deputy manager of the Equipment Management Department, explained that the Ziyang Gas Power Station is the first H-class gas-fired power station operational in southwest China, utilizing the globally advanced M701J H-class gas-steam combined cycle units. He highlighted three key advantages: ultra-low emissions, with sulfur dioxide levels far below national standards and near-zero particulate matter, making it a truly green power source; flexible start-stop capabilities, effectively regulating grid load and ensuring supply-demand balance; and high conversion efficiency, with over 63% of natural gas converted into electricity on-site, far exceeding traditional thermal power.

"We are efficiently converting the local 'rich deposit' into clean electricity, serving the provincial power grid while retaining more value and tax revenue in Anyue," Qu Ming added. Looking ahead, Anyue aims to advance the conversion and utilization of natural gas from "having" to "excelling" and from "excelling" to "leading." According to the 15th Five-Year Plan, based on the stable operation of Phase I gas power, the county will accelerate preliminary work for Phase II. It will also vigorously pursue strategic projects like a domestic heavy-duty gas turbine testing base and a molten pyrolysis natural gas base, promoting the shift of natural gas from a "fuel" to a "feedstock."

Concurrently, plans are underway to build a 6-square-kilometer natural gas clean energy industrial cluster and a 2.5-square-kilometer natural gas industrial park. These will focus on high-end chemical projects such as carbon nanotube co-production and new materials derived from natural gas, constructing a diversified, high-value industrial system.
